Transaction

3f60d752bb7178dd3ce67fa4d4ba7975317a1b2e6327c1bcd0009a3dab6107bb

Summary

In Block691154
TimeSun, 18 Jun 2017 00:23:23 UTC
Total Input1006.10330214 PIV
Total Output1010.60329174 PIV
Fees0 PIV

Details

Fee: 0 PIV
3968406 Confirmations1010.60329174 PIV
Raw Transaction